Transaction d1bc160bf944ec48b9b6369b589febcd74419864094e4522f9e823f168ae9aad

1 Input
2 Outputs
  • d1bc160bf944ec48b9b6369b589febcd74419864094e4522f9e823f168ae9aad:0
  • value  12876292
    address  3L5L8XwZoPzuojfSBP26rSiPcbs8dthkYc
  • d1bc160bf944ec48b9b6369b589febcd74419864094e4522f9e823f168ae9aad:1
  • value  1509676
    address  1B43iVJ7pRHwxanxLKdj3yjDhVAVupDXwY